Artifact (2003) is a top-down strategy game with an educational twist from the developers at Engine Software B.V.. The game's main publisher is Foreign Media Games... Read more
System Requirements Artifact (2003)
This game does not list PC as a target platform.If the game is decided to be released on PC, the system requirements for it will appear on this page.